Cookies and Similar Technologies
A cookie is a small text file that a website stores on your device. We and our service providers use cookies and similar technologies on the Site to operate it, understand how it is used, and support our advertising. The cookies used on the Site generally fall into the following categories:
- strictly necessary cookies, which are required for the Site to function;
- performance and analytics cookies, which help us understand how visitors use the Site;
- functional cookies, which remember your preferences; and
- advertising cookies, which may be used to measure and improve the relevance of our advertising.
When you first visit the Site, you are presented with a cookie notice and may accept or manage cookies. You can also control cookies through your browser settings, which typically allow you to block or delete them. If you block certain cookies, some features of the Site may not function properly.

Advertising and Your Choices
You have choices about how your information is used for advertising and analytics:
- Google ad settings. You can manage the ads Google shows you at https://myadcenter.google.com.
- Industry opt-outs. You can opt out of interest-based advertising from participating companies through the Network Advertising Initiative at https://optout.networkadvertising.org or the Digital Advertising Alliance at https://optout.aboutads.info.
- Google Analytics. You can opt out using the browser add-on at https://tools.google.com/dlpage/gaoptout.
- Browser and device controls. You can adjust your browser or device settings to block or delete cookies and to limit ad tracking.
Opting out of interest-based advertising does not mean you will stop seeing ads; it means the ads you see may be less relevant to you. Because opt-out preferences are typically stored in cookies, you may need to renew your choices if you delete cookies or use a different browser or device.

Do Not Track and Global Privacy Control
Some browsers offer a “Do Not Track” signal. Because there is no common industry standard for responding to these signals, we do not currently respond to them. However, where required by applicable law, we will treat a recognized opt-out preference signal, such as the Global Privacy Control, as a valid request to opt out of the sale or sharing of personal information and of targeted advertising for the browser or device from which the signal is received.
